Key Facts

  • Kepler-160c is credited with the discovery of Kepler Space Telescope[2].
  • Kepler-160c's instance of is recorded as exoplanet[3].
  • Kepler-160c's constellation is recorded as Lyra[4].
  • Kepler-160c's parent astronomical body is recorded as Kepler-160[5].
  • Kepler-160c's catalog code is recorded as Kepler-160c[6].
  • Kepler-160c's catalog code is recorded as KOI-456.01[7].
  • Kepler-160c's catalog code is recorded as KOI-456c[8].
  • Kepler-160c's catalog code is recorded as TIC 158555483c[9].
  • Kepler-160c's time of discovery or invention is recorded as +2014-03-00T00:00:00Z[10].
  • Kepler-160c's discovery method is recorded as transit method[11].
